Normally the service is provided by a lease agreement and the service provider can, in some configurations, use the same changing equipment to service multiple hosted PBX consumers. The very first hosted PBX services were feature-rich compared to a lot of premises-based systems of the time. Some PBX functions, such as follow-me calling, appeared in a hosted service prior to they ended up being offered in hardware PBX devices.
This allows one extension to ring in numerous locations (either concurrently or sequentially) (Business Phone System). enables scalability so that a bigger system is not required if brand-new employees are worked with, therefore that resources are not lost if the number of staff members is decreased. eliminates the need for companies to manage or spend for on-site hardware maintenance.

However our preferred aspect of the system is its unique "Vi" (Voice Intelligence) analytics include, which processes your discussions as they occur and transcribes them into an easily readable format. Somewhat futuristically, it can acknowledge action products that turn up throughout your calls and automatically style them into order of business for you, while also making note of unfavorable and favorable sentiments in the discussion.
What we find most compelling about this system, though, is how personalized its pricing packages are. Instead of signing your entire group onto one rate strategy, you can mix and match putting some employee onto the cheapest, most standard strategy, and others onto the more costly tiers. This makes a lot of sense when you have some staff member who'll only need the system to make infrequent calls and sign up with in on team meetings and partnerships, and others who'll need more sophisticated features, such as call recording, voicemail transcription, and integration with the CRM platform they use.
